Abstract
AI is reshaping many business fields, but can it reliably assist practitioners in solving optimization problems?
This talk explores how Gurobi users can leverage Generative AI in their workflows. We discuss chat bots like the "Gurobot" and the "Gurobi AI Modeling Assistant" (both based on ChatGPT). Through examples, we will examine when AI enhances workflows and when human expertise remains essential.
